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34692 67972394 45203 32582
74924 815104629 62543890577
74924 815104629 62543890577
610873 679 61501204 818 8627
All about undefined
Interested in learning more?
74924 815104629 62543890577
610873 679 61501204 818 8627
See more
42927848639 02940101380 8124035871
4685708654 46077500 715 781635685 27
See more
454185457 19
251 07499460 458
See more